Dudley — Special Educational Needs Provision 2024/25

In Dudley, 5.69% of pupils have an EHCP and 14.23% receive SEN support (England: 5.34% / 14.22%). Real DfE data (OGL v3.0).

How Dudley's GSNEPI is calculated

The Gera Special Educational Needs Provision Index for Dudley is 88.3, computed from three components:

  • EHCP Rate Component: min(5.69% ÷ 5.34% × 100, 200) = 106.6
  • SEN Support Rate Component: min(14.23% ÷ 14.22% × 100, 200) = 100.1
  • Specialist Places Component: 20.4 ÷ 34.997 × 100 = 58.4
  • GSNEPI = (106.6 + 100.1 + 58.4) ÷ 3 = 88.3

England national averages used: EHCP rate 5.34%, SEN support rate 14.22% (DfE SEN in England 2024/25). Full methodology: GSNEPI methodology.
